Cultural Significance
Hanoi’s cultural significance is beautifully illustrated through its historic landmarks, each telling a story of the city’s rich heritage.
The Tran Quoc Pagoda, with its ancient architectural beauty, stands as a testament to Vietnam’s enduring spiritual traditions. Dating back over 1,500 years, it reflects the deep-rooted connection between the Vietnamese people and their beliefs.
Ngoc Son Temple, uniquely perched on Hoan Kiem Lake, showcases exquisite architecture and serves as a focal point for local spirituality and community gatherings.
Meanwhile, the Temple of Literature, Vietnam’s first university, highlights the country’s commitment to education and Confucian values.
Together, these sites embody the essence of Hanoi’s cultural identity, inviting visitors to connect with its profound history and vibrant traditions.

Local Etiquette and Customs
As travelers enjoy the vibrant culture of Hanoi, understanding local etiquette and customs enhances their experience. Respecting these traditions not only fosters goodwill but also enriches their journey through this captivating city.
Here are three key customs to keep in mind:
Greetings: A friendly smile and a slight bow or nod are common when meeting someone. Handshakes are also acceptable among acquaintances.
Dining Etiquette: Always wait for the host to begin eating. It’s polite to try a bit of everything offered, and don’t stick your chopsticks upright in your rice.
Dress Code: When visiting temples or pagodas, modest clothing is essential. Shoulders and knees should be covered to show respect.
